There are quite a few directions this album goes, and many musical territories they were going after. Lazarus has a bit of a folky feel on some tunes, like a Jackson Browne, but then they go more towards a New Orleans ragtime feel on other tunes. I thought it was fairly decent, and loved the Bob Marley cover of "Small Axe" which had a unique rock spin on it. It wasn't too bad, worth a listen for sure. Tracks 2, 4, 5, and 8 were a few of my favorites.
